pycham上安装pyuic显示filenamefilenamewithutextension未定义是什么意思
时间: 2024-05-14 20:17:45 浏览: 8
这个错误通常是因为您在PyCharm中使用了PyUIC的命令行工具,但是没有定义文件名和/或文件名的扩展名。
请确保您在PyCharm的命令行参数中正确指定了要转换的UI文件的文件名和扩展名。例如,如果您要转换名为"my_ui_file.ui"的UI文件,则应该在PyCharm的命令行参数中输入以下内容:
```
pyuic my_ui_file.ui -o my_ui_file.py
```
在这个例子中,"-o"选项指定输出文件的名称,它将生成一个名为"my_ui_file.py"的Python文件。
如果您仍然遇到问题,请确保您已经正确安装了PyUIC工具,并且已将其添加到系统路径中。
相关问题
pyuic和pyrcc分别是什么
pyuic和pyrcc是两个PyQt5工具程序,用于将Qt Designer设计的.ui文件和.qrc文件转换为Python代码。具体来说:
1. pyuic是一个用户界面代码生成器,用于将Qt Designer设计的.ui文件转换为Python代码。通过这个工具,可以将Qt Designer中设计的用户界面直接转换为Python代码,方便在Python代码中使用。
2. pyrcc是一个资源文件转换器,用于将Qt Designer设计的.qrc文件转换为Python代码。通过这个工具,可以将Qt Designer中设计的资源文件直接转换为Python代码,方便在Python代码中使用。
需要注意的是,这两个工具程序是PyQt5库中的一部分,需要提前安装PyQt5库才能使用。
python安装pyuic
好的,关于安装pyuic,你可以按照以下步骤进行:
1. 确认你已经安装了Python,可以在命令行中输入`python --version`来检查Python版本。
2. 安装PyQt5,可以使用pip命令来安装,命令为`pip install PyQt5`。
3. 找到PyQt5安装目录下的pyuic5.bat文件,一般在Python安装目录下的Scripts文件夹中。
4. 将pyuic5.bat文件所在的目录添加到系统环境变量中,这样就可以在任意位置使用pyuic5命令了。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)